How does asphalt shingle roof installation compare to other roofing options in terms of durability? Asphalt shingle roofs generally offer good durability for residential applications, though some other options like metal or tile roofing may last longer and withstand harsher conditions. Local contractors can provide insights into how each option performs in specific climates and conditions.
Are asphalt shingle roofs easier to install than other roofing types? Yes, asphalt shingle roof installation is typically quicker and less complex compared to options like slate or tile roofs, which require specialized skills and equipment. Local service providers can advise on the installation process based on the chosen roofing material.
How does maintenance for asphalt shingle roofs compare to other roofing options? Asphalt shingle roofs usually require regular inspections and occasional repairs, whereas some other options like metal or tile roofs might need less frequent maintenance but can be more costly to repair when needed. Local pros can help determine the maintenance needs for different roofing types.
What are the aesthetic differences between asphalt shingle roofs and other roofing options? Asphalt shingles come in a variety of colors and styles, offering versatile aesthetic options, while materials like metal, tile, or wood may provide different textures and appearances.
